Skin, born in London and now 57, initially pursued a career in interior design before becoming the lead singer of the renowned band Skunk Anansie in 1994. The band achieved widespread acclaim with hit singles such as “Weak” and “Hedonism.” In 1999, Skin made history as the first black woman to headline Glastonbury. After a break in the early 2000s, Skunk Anansie reunited in 2009. Their latest single, “An Artist Is An Artist,” is out now, and they will kick off a UK and European tour on February 28. Skin currently resides between New York and London with her partner, LadyFag, and their three-year-old daughter.
